
Make sure your computer is off.
Press the power button to turn on your PC and immediately press F8 at a 1-second interval.
Press the arrow keys to navigate to Safe Mode with Networking and press Enter.
Now you’ve successfully booted up in Safe Mode with Networking, continue with Step 2 to troubleshoot the CLASSPNP.SYS blue screen problem.

What does classpnp.sys mean in Windows 10?
Classpnp.sys is an important Windows Microsoft SCSI class system file that is part of this Windows operating system. While regular potential customers never need to know anything about this CLASSPNP.SYS file, sometimes you can also encounter errors related to these vital system device drivers. A CLASSPNP.SYS error is considered a BSOD error and this element renders the affected computer unusable.

What kind of file is classpnp.sys in Windows?
Classpnp.sys is considered a type of SCSI system variant dll file. It is most commonly supported on Microsoft® Windows® operating systems developed by Microsoft. Uses the SYS file extension and is considered a huge Win32 EXE (driver) file.
